The Act establishes the Task Force on the Impact of the Affordable Housing Crisis, which is tasked with evaluating the impact of a lack of affordable housing on various aspects of life and making recommendations to Congress. It defines "affordable housing" and outlines the establishment and composition of the Task Force. The Task Force is required to complete a comprehensive report, utilize available data, hold hearings, and gather information from federal agencies. It must submit a final report to the designated congressional committees and terminate within 2 years. Funding is authorized for fiscal years 2027 through 2030.

The primary form of legislative measure used to propose law. Depending on the chamber of origin, bills begin with a designation of either H.R. or S. Joint resolution is another form of legislative measure used to propose law.

Primary focus of measure is U.S. banking and financial institutions regulation; consumer credit; bankruptcy and debt collection; financial services and investments; insurance; securities; real estate transactions; currency. Measures concerning financial crimes may fall under Crime and Law Enforcement. Measures concerning business and corporate finance may fall under Commerce policy area. Measures concerning international banking may fall under Foreign Trade and International Finance policy area.
